What is Rocketrip? - Company Overview & Details
In a world where corporate travel expenses can quickly spiral out of control, organizations are seeking innovative ways to manage costs while keeping employees motivated. Enter Rocketrip, a company that has carved a niche in the travel management sector by incentivizing employees to save money on business trips. Founded in 2013, Rocketrip operates out of New York City and has developed a unique rewards program that not only reduces travel costs but also engages employees in the process.
Who Founded Rocketrip?
Rocketrip was founded by Dan Ruch, a visionary entrepreneur who recognized the potential for a more efficient and cost-effective approach to corporate travel. His leadership has been instrumental in shaping the company's strategic vision and fostering a culture of innovation.

How Rocketrip Works
Rocketrip's innovative approach revolves around a simple yet effective premise: incentivizing employees to be cost-conscious during business travel. Here’s how it works:
-
Setting a Budget: Companies set a budget for travel expenses based on historical data and expected costs.
-
Employee Engagement: Employees are encouraged to book their travel within this budget. If they manage to spend less than the allocated amount, they receive a reward.
-
Rewards Program: The savings generated by employees are shared with them through various rewards, such as gift cards, cash bonuses, or donations to charity. This not only encourages spending less but also creates a sense of ownership and accountability.
-
Real-Time Data and Insights: The platform provides companies with valuable insights into travel spending patterns, enabling better decision-making and strategic planning in the future.

Real-World Example
Consider a mid-sized technology company that frequently sends employees to conferences across the country. By integrating Rocketrip into their travel planning process, they initially set a budget of $1,500 per trip. An employee who books a trip for $1,200 would earn a reward based on the savings of $300. This not only motivates the employee to seek out cost-effective options—like using alternative accommodations or booking flights during off-peak times—but also results in significant savings for the company.
